SOUTHWEST HARBOR – Phyllis W. Closson, 89, died Dec. 10, 2003, after a brief illness at the Oak Hill Hospital, Brooksville, Fla. She was born Jan. 16, 1914, in Southwest Harbor, the daughter of Raymond C. and Mildred (Savage) Whitmore. Phyllis was educated at the schools in Southwest Harbor and then graduated from Castine Normal School in 1934. She taught schools a few years and then served as librarian at the public library in Southwest Harbor. She was a lifetime resident of the town of Southwest Harbor. She is survived by a son, Jerry W.
